Plain Perfect by Beth Wiseman (2008, Paperback) 
Plain Perfect by Beth Wiseman (2008, Paperback)

 
Plain Perfect by Beth Wiseman (2008, Paperback)

Author: Beth Wiseman
Publisher: Thomas Nelson Inc
Publication Date: 2008-09-09
Series: Daughters of Promise Novel
Language: English
Format: Paperback
ISBN-10: 1595546308
ISBN-13: 9781595546302

I bought the book because I'd read all of my other Amish books by other authors.
I'd never read anything by Beth Wiseman but saw how people were grabbing her books up like mad.I made my purchase then I bought two more which were the 2nd & 3rd books in this series.I love how God worked through Lillian to bring her Mother back home to see her parents alive one last time.
Amazing how one man Samuel was given another chance to love after the passing of Rachel years earlier.David knew before they did that they were made for each other.I loved it when both Sarah jane and daughter Lillian both joined the Amish faith at the same day.I cried when Irma passed,I never saw it coming she always looked after her ailing husband Jonas and I thought surely he'd die first like everyone else.Now I'm hooked on Beth Wiseman's books.As long s she writes books I'll read them.

For the past year or two I have enjoyed reading stories that involve the Amish and their lifestyle. This is my first book by Beth Wiseman and I enjoyed it very much. In fact I just received the second book in this particular series.

Plain Perfect was very good, although I can't help but wonder if it was very realistic. It's hard to believe that a person could fairly easily adapt to the Amish lifestyle - but irregardless, I still enjoyed the storyline and the wonderful characters.
